Я использую macvim, созданный с поддержкой интерпретатора python на OS X lion, для кодирования на python.
Для полного завершения работы с библиотеками для конкретного питона
virtualenv Я бы хотел, чтобы macvim узнал, что он открыт в активированном
python virtualenv.
В Ubuntu это работает точно так, как я ожидаю;
Если я открою vim и активирую virtualenv, все библиотеки, специфичные для этого virtualenv, будут на Python
дорожка. Это не работает в macvim при запуске из сценария оболочки mvim внутри
активированный virtualenv. Вместо этого путь Python состоит из глобальных библиотек Python.
Я знаю, что есть способ обойти это с некоторыми полутяжелыми vim-скриптами, но я бы
предпочитаю, если он ведет себя как на Ubuntu. Я бы по крайней мере хотел бы знать, почему это не
вести себя так. Любые идеи приветствуются.